Crisis Management Organization: No Toxic Gas Detected at Rajaei Port

1 Min Read

The Crisis Management Organization has not detected any toxic gas at Rajaee Port.

The head of the National Crisis Management Organization stated that the presence of toxic gases at Rajaee Port after the fire is not true.

We have controlled the fire in most areas and are currently mopping up by creating several fronts.

Ninety-nine percent of the emergency and Red Crescent rescue personnel did not use masks, and no cases of poisoning due to toxic gases have been observed in this area.
